Design kit

Clean, not overwhelming, opinionated. One typeface, one accent, plenty of room. Hierarchy comes from size and space — not heavy weights or extra colour.

Principles

  • Monospace voice. One typeface everywhere — it reads precise, technical, and calm.
  • One accent. A single green, used sparingly — links, labels, the line that matters. Everything else is ink on paper.
  • Hairlines and air. Thin borders, white cards on warm paper, generous whitespace. No gradients, no shadows, no clutter.
  • Size and space over weight. Regular and medium carry the text; semibold marks headings and labels, with bold reserved for subsection headings. Scale and spacing still do most of the hierarchy.
  • Drafting-paper framing. Dashed hairlines frame the text column and divide sections; figures get corner brackets. Corners stay square — buttons and cards included. Structure you can feel, not decoration.
  • Plainspoken and precise. Short, declarative sentences in plain English — no hype, no jargon, no exclamation marks. Always speak to "you," and never call Felix "it." Calm, confident, opinionated: say what's true and let the words stand.

Logomark

Top-right and bottom-left corner brackets framing a single focus square — the drafting-paper frame distilled to a mark, drawn entirely in the green accent. It always pairs to the left of the "Felix" wordmark.

Construction & usage
  • One colour throughout — brackets and focus square are the same green accent. Never recolour it or split it into two tones.
  • Square corners, square line caps. No rounding, no gradient, no container tile.
  • The favicon zooms in — tighter padding, heavier stroke, a single colour — so it stays legible at 16px and lifts to the brighter green on dark tabs.
  • Keep clear space around the mark at least the length of a bracket arm; set it tight to the wordmark but never overlapping.
Direction — the mark as an up/down signal

Up is green with brackets top-right + bottom-left (the "/" diagonal); down is red with brackets top-left + bottom-right (the "\" diagonal). The diagonal carries the meaning, colour reinforces it — so always pair the mark with a signed value, since at small sizes colour does most of the work.

Typography

JetBrains Mono — regular (400) and medium (500) for text, semibold (600) for headings and labels, bold (700) for subsection headings. System monospace as fallback.
